Development Process

How Your App Gets Built

Building an app requires more upfront planning than a website. I take the time to understand your users before writing a line of code.

1
Requirements & Scope

We define the app's features, user flow, and technical needs. I provide a scope document before any development begins.

2
UI/UX Wireframes

Low-fidelity wireframes for every screen so we agree on the experience before the build phase.

3
Frontend Development

Ionic + Vue.js components built screen by screen, connected to mock data first for fast visual feedback.

4
Backend & API

REST API setup with Node.js or PHP, database schema, and authentication - wired to the frontend.

5
Testing

Device testing on Android and iOS emulators, plus a real device if available. Bug fixes included.

6
Deployment & Handover

APK/IPA build, store submission support, and code handover with documentation.

A hybrid app is built once using web technologies (Ionic + Vue.js) and runs on Android, iOS, and web. It's more cost-effective than building separate native apps, with near-native performance for most use cases.

An MVP with 5 screens takes 3–4 weeks. A full app with 15 screens and a backend typically takes 6–10 weeks.
